Democrats' Health Bill: Buy Insurance or Go To Jail

The Democrats' bill that will be voted on in the House tomorrow says a family of four either needs to buy insurance for $15,000 per year, pay a penalty tax of 2.5% of income or face a penalty of up to $250,000 and/or imprisonment of up to five years. This should be popular.


Quote:
?H.R. 3962 provides that an individual (or a husband and wife in the case of a joint return) who does not, at any time during the taxable year, maintain acceptable health insurance coverage for himself or herself and each of his or her qualifying children is subject to an additional tax.? [page 1]

- ? - ? - ? - ? - ?

?If the government determines that the taxpayer?s unpaid tax liability results from willful behavior, the following penalties could apply?? [page 2]

- ? - ? - ? - ? - -

?Criminal penalties

Prosecution is authorized under the Code for a variety of offenses. Depending on the level of the noncompliance, the following penalties could apply to an individual:

? Section 7203 ? misdemeanor willful failure to pay is punishable by a fine of up to $25,000 and/or imprisonment of up to one year.

? Section 7201 ? felony willful evasion is punishable by a fine of up to $250,000 and/or imprisonment of up to five years.? [page 3]
Quote:

According to the Congressional Budget Office the lowest cost family non-group plan under the Speaker?s bill would cost $15,000 in 2016.

I read through the letter you linked and I do agree that a person who doesn't maintain health insurance during the year probably should not be penalized. I can, however, see why they would do this.

One of the major problems with health care is the non-payers. These are people who go to the ER and urgent care centers and get treatment then don't pay. That cost is then passed on to everyone else. So if a person just doesn't want health insurance for no legit reason and ends up becoming a non-payer we all then get to pay for them. You are forced to carry car insurance if you drive, I think they are using the same principles here. I also think they are expecting to supply enough subsidies that anyone can get health insurance no matter how little money you make so the only reason for not having it would be that you just decided that you don't need it and don't want it even if the government is paying for it.

Still, sending someone to jail over this is pretty extreme. However, if you read the full letter at the bottom it says that out of all the cases they were filed in 2008 only about 100 were cases where they determined the taxpayer?s unpaid tax liability results from willful behavior. Obviously this doesn't include health care since we don't have it yet, but I think the point is that very few people will fall into this area. The rest will just be taxed what it would cost them to have health insurance. From what I read you can make up to around 80K a year and you will still get some kind of government assistance for health insurance so I don't think this clause will effect many people.

Tax evasion is a crime in and of itself. It is not related to the health care bill. The penalty for not having health insurance is 2.5%. Everything else is seperate.

What you are essentially saying is this. I get a parking ticket and show up to court. I start yelling obscenities at the judge and get charged with contempt of court and serve 30 days in jail. Therefore, the penalty for parking illegally is 30 days in jail.

Failure to pay a fine or serve your sentence is a completely different crime in this country. Before you spout off on people calling them illiterate, you should educate yourself on our judicial system before you continue to make a larger fool of yourself.

And my post is not a statement in favor or in opposition of the proposed health care bill.
